PROCEDURE

实验过程

(2-Oxopyrrolidin-1-yl)acetaldehyde (2.00 g, 15.7 mmol) and ethyl 3-amino-5-(4-fluorobenzyl)-2-pyridinecarboxylate (2.00 g, 7.32 mmol) were combined in 1:1 dichloroethane/acetic acid (10 mL) and cooled under nitrogen to 0-5° C. Sodium trisacetoxyborohydride (3.10 g, 14.6 mmol) was added and the reaction was stirred for 15 min. Two additional portions of aldehyde (1.0 g, 7.8 mmol) plus sodium triacetoxyborohydride (1.65 g, 7.8 mmol) separated by 15 min. increments were made. The reaction mixture was evaporated in vacuo, dissolved in CH2Cl2, and treated with aqueous K2CO3 (5% w/v). After separating the layers, the aqueous phase was back-extracted twice with CH2Cl2. The combined organic phases were dried over MgSO4, filtered, evaporated in vacuo and purified on silica gel eluting with 0-3% MeOH in EtOAc to provide an oil: 1H NMR (CDCl3) δ 7.89 (1H, d, J=1.4 Hz), 7.83 (1H, br t, J˜6 Hz), 7.15 (2H, dd, J˜9, 6 Hz), 6.98 (2H, t, J˜9 Hz), 6.92 (1H, s), 4.42 (2H, q, J=7 Hz), 3.92 (2H, s), 3.49 (2H, m), 3.41 (2H, t, J=7 Hz), 3.35 (2H, q, J=6 Hz), 2.36 (2H, t, J=8 Hz), 1.99 (2H, m), 1.42 (3H, t, J=7 Hz); ES+ MS: 386 (M+H+).
